Remove-WebBinding

Remove-WebBinding

Removes a binding from an IIS website.

構文

Parameter Set: InputBindingProperties
Remove-WebBinding [-HostHeader <String> ] [-IPAddress <String> ] [-Name <String> ] [-Port <String> ] [-Protocol <String> ] [-Confirm] [-WhatIf] [ <CommonParameters>]

Parameter Set: InputBindingInformation
Remove-WebBinding -BindingInformation <String> [-Name <String> ] [-Protocol <String> ] [-Confirm] [-WhatIf] [ <CommonParameters>]

Parameter Set: InputObject
Remove-WebBinding -InputObject <PSObject> [-Name <String> ] [-Protocol <String> ] [-Confirm] [-WhatIf] [ <CommonParameters>]




詳細説明

The Remove-WebBinding cmdlet removes a binding from an Internet Information Services (IIS) website.

パラメーター

-BindingInformation<String>

Specifies a BindingInformation object.


エイリアス

なし

必須?

true

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ByPropertyName)

ワイルドカード文字を許可する

false

-HostHeader<String>

Specifies the host header of the site binding that this cmdlet removes.


エイリアス

なし

必須?

false

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ByPropertyName)

ワイルドカード文字を許可する

false

-IPAddress<String>

Specifies the IP address of the site from which this cmdlet removes the binding. You can use globbing (*) to specify all IP addresses.


エイリアス

なし

必須?

false

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ByPropertyName)

ワイルドカード文字を許可する

false

-InputObject<PSObject>

Specifies an input object that contains site binding information.


エイリアス

なし

必須?

true

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ByValue)

ワイルドカード文字を許可する

false

-Name<String>

Specifies the name of the site from which this cmdlet removes the binding.


エイリアス

なし

必須?

false

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ByPropertyName)

ワイルドカード文字を許可する

false

-Port<String>

Specifies the port used by the binding that this cmdlet removes.


エイリアス

なし

必須?

false

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ByPropertyName)

ワイルドカード文字を許可する

false

-Protocol<String>

Specifies the protocol of the binding that this cmdlet removes.


エイリアス

なし

必須?

false

位置は?

named

既定値

なし

パイプライン入力を許可する

true (ByPropertyName)

ワイルドカード文字を許可する

false

-Confirm

コマンドレットを実行する前に、ユーザーに確認を求めます。


必須?

false

位置は?

named

既定値

false

パイプライン入力を許可する

false

ワイルドカード文字を許可する

false

-WhatIf

コマンドレットを実行するとどのような結果になるかを表示します。コマンドレットは実行されません。


必須?

false

位置は?

named

既定値

false

パイプライン入力を許可する

false

ワイルドカード文字を許可する

false

<CommonParameters>

このコマンドレットは次の共通パラメーターをサポートします。-Verbose、-Debug、-ErrorAction、-ErrorVariable、-OutBuffer、-OutVariable.詳細については、以下を参照してください。 about_CommonParameters (http://go.microsoft.com/fwlink/p/?LinkID=113216)。

入力

入力型は、コマンドレットにパイプできるオブジェクトの型です。

出力

出力型は、コマンドレットによって生成されるオブジェクトの型です。

Example-------------- EXAMPLEExample 1: Adding and removeing a site binding --------------e

This example creates a binding, and then removes that binding after waiting 5 seconds. The second command uses the Get-WebBinding cmdlet to get the new binding, and then passes it to the current cmdlet by using the pipeline operator.


IIS:\>New-WebBinding -Name "Default Web Site" -Port 1234 -IPAddress "*" -HostHeader "testsite" "Sleep 5 seconds before removing the binding"; Sleep 5 
IIS:\> Get-WebBinding -Port 1234 -Name "Default Web Site" | Remove-WebBinding

関連トピック

コミュニティの追加

追加
表示: